Understanding Asset-Based Lending in Colorado

In Colorado, asset-based lending is a financing option that leverages an individual’s or business’s assets—such as real estate, equipment, or inventory—as collateral to secure a loan. This approach stands in contrast to traditional lending methods that primarily rely on creditworthiness and personal history. Asset-based lending offers flexibility by providing access to capital without the stringent requirements often associated with unsecured loans. It is particularly appealing for business owners seeking funding for expansion, as it allows them to leverage their existing assets while still enjoying potentially lower interest rates and more extended repayment periods compared to standard business loans.

Colorado’s financial landscape is enriched by numerous lenders specializing in asset-based financing, catering to a diverse range of borrowers, from small businesses to large corporations. These lenders employ sophisticated evaluation methods to assess the value of collateral, ensuring fair loan terms while mitigating risk. When exploring flexible repayment terms, especially in the context of asset-based lending Colorado offers, understanding your options is key. Lenders often provide a range of repayment structures tailored to different borrower needs. These can include varied interest rates, loan term extensions, and customizable payment schedules. The right fit depends on your financial situation, goals, and the specific terms presented by each lender.

Start by assessing your assets and income. Asset-based lending considers the value of your collateral, so evaluating your holdings can help determine loan amounts and repayment flexibility. Researching different lenders in Colorado allows you to compare their terms, rates, and any additional benefits or requirements. Finding the right fit means selecting a lender whose conditions align with your ability to repay while offering terms that support your financial objectives.
